An environmentally friendly process will be used. According to the invention, a sublayer composed of metal or metal alloys or a chemical compound is sputtered onto the metal or metal layer under plasma support. On said sublayer, the corrosion protection layer composed of the same or a different material type than the sublayer is deposited under plasma support. A cover layer again made of the same or a different material type is sputtered onto the corrosion protection layer under plasma support. The main application of the corrosion-protected metal is in the metal-processing industry.
